1968-1970 FORD MUSTANG DUAL EXHAUST SYSTEM, ALUMINIZED WITH 428 ENGINES ONLY
 
 
INCLUDED IN THE KIT ARE:
  • FRONT H-PIPE
  • LEFT & RIGHT CONNECTORS
  • SINGLE TRANSVERSE MUFFLER
  • LEFT & RIGHT TAILPIPES
****RESONATORS ARE NOT INCLUDED****

Tunnels get F1 ace Räikkönen buzzing

Tue, 26 Aug 2014

FERRARI's Formula One aces Fernando Alonso and Kimi Räikkönen put pleasure before business at the Belgian Grand Prix weekend, taking to a specially-made track in a hyper-exclusive 458 Speciale in a test of driving excitement. The stars travelled down the road from the famous Spa circuit to an event hosted by Shell, Ferrari's fuels and lubricants partner, where a 1.2km circuit built for excitement had been put together, featuring a tunnel full of laser lighting, a simulated winter corner with authentic whirling snow, and an F1-style starting grid. The tunnel flicked Kimi's switch more than any other part of the track, with the telemetry showing a spike in excitement levels as he hit the power through the multi-coloured lasers and smoke.
